Barbara Ellen Yurth 1926 - 2013

Barbara Ellen Yurth was born on December 23, 1926, and died at age 86 years old on January 2, 2013. Barbara Yurth was buried at Utah State Veterans Cemetery Section B Site 671 P. O. In 1926, in the year that Barbara Ellen Yurth was born, on November 15th, NBC was founded. It was the U.S.'s first major broadcast network. Ownership of the network was split between RCA (a majority partner at 50%), its founding corporate parent General Electric (which owned 30%), and Westinghouse (which owned the remaining 20%).
